Algorithm for Improving the Performance of Metaheuristic Optimizers

(The Combination Lock Algorithm)

Population-based metaheuristic algorithms are promising search methods for solving optimisation problems. A systematic pre-processing approach, called the combination lock algorithm, for obtaining a good starting point for population-based algorithms, is proposed to enhance the performance of the metaheuristic optimisers.
